const XObjectPtr VariablesStack::getParamVariable const XalanQName qname,
StylesheetExecutionContext executionContext,
bool &  fNameFound
 

Given a name, return a string representing the value, but don't look in the global space.

Since the variable may not yet have been evaluated, this may return a null XObjectPtr.

Parameters:
theName name of variable
exeuctionContext the current execution context
fNameFound set to true if the name was found, false if not.
Returns:
pointer to XObject for variable

size_type VariablesStack::getStackSize  )  const
 

const XObjectPtr VariablesStack::getVariable const XalanQName qname,
StylesheetExecutionContext executionContext,
bool &  fNameFound
 

Given a name, find the corresponding XObject.

If the variable exists, but has not yet been evaluated, the variable will be evaluated and the result returned. This may return a null XObjectPtr, if the variable was not found.

Parameters:
qname name of variable
exeuctionContext the current execution context
fNameFound set to true if the name was found, false if not.
Returns:
pointer to the corresponding XObject

void VariablesStack::pushParams const ParamsVectorType theParams  ) 
 

Push the provided objects as parameters.

You must call popContextMarker() when you are done with the arguments.

Parameters:
theParam The vector containing the parameters.

void VariablesStack::pushVariable const XalanQName name,
const XObjectPtr val,
const ElemTemplateElement e
 

Push a named variable onto the processor variable stack.

Don't forget to call startContext before pushing a series of arguments for a given template.

Parameters:
name name of variable
val pointer to XObject value
e element marker for variable

void VariablesStack::pushVariable const XalanQName name,
const ElemVariable var,
const ElemTemplateElement e
 

Push a named variable onto the processor variable stack.

Don't forget to call startContext before pushing a series of arguments for a given template.

Parameters:
name name of variable
val pointer to ElemVariable
e element marker for variable
